Position Overview
The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Specialist is responsible for supporting and maintaining environmental, health, safety, and security programs across the facility. This role ensures compliance with OSHA, EPA, and other applicable regulations while promoting a proactive safety culture. The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Specialist will assist in developing and implementing policies, conducting inspections and audits, investigating incidents, and driving continuous improvement initiatives related to workplace safety, environmental stewardship, and site security.

Responsibilities Of The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Specialist

  • Monitor and ensure compliance with OSHA, EPA, and company EHS standards and policies.
  • Conduct regular safety, environmental, and security inspections and audits.
  • Assist in developing, implementing, and maintaining EHS programs and procedures.
  • Investigate workplace incidents, accidents, and near misses; identify root causes and recommend corrective actions.
  • Coordinate safety training programs and maintain training records.
  • Support emergency preparedness and response planning activities.
  • Manage environmental compliance programs, including waste management and regulatory reporting as required.
  • Track and maintain EHS metrics, documentation, and reporting requirements.
  • Manage and support facility security programs, including access control, visitor management, CCTV monitoring, C-TPAT compliance, security investigations, risk assessments, employee training, and maintenance of security policies and procedures to ensure regulatory compliance and asset protection.
